Contractor Directory

Siller Stairs LA

Tags stairs

8383 Wilshire Blvd Suite 800

Los Angeles, CA 90211

(323) 284-5063

View Website

Siller Stairs is an Italian contemporary stair designer and producer, specializing in high-end projects, requiring exclusive quality and WOW effect. Developed in the 1950's, Siller Stairs gained a lot of experience in the construction market, having happy customers in all continents of the globe. If you need assistance in building your perfect staircase - just contact us

Siller Stairs LA Overview

Tags stairs

This listing doesn't have an overview yet.

Siller Stairs LA Photos

This listing doesn't have any photos yet.

Siller Stairs LA Videos


This listing doesn't have any videos yet.